Output d36cc09e0248f331f2f70eea7697e19c1e54b0a0e78e04420b121b5660b9c56e:0

value
12327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b6efec75e677a5bdccbf148c61193858e91af4 OP_EQUAL
address
39sPDKJDYz9whhucqBQpYNZNnfumd9pAuX
transaction
d36cc09e0248f331f2f70eea7697e19c1e54b0a0e78e04420b121b5660b9c56e
spent
true